33. To devises and bequests contained in the Last Will
and Testament of Mary L. Lee, late of Baltimore City,
deceased, of record in the Office of the Register of Wills of
Baltimore City, in Wills Liber J. H. B. 186, folio 524, viz:

Loyola High School of Baltimore, Inc.

34. To devises and bequests contained in the Last Will
and Testament of Bernard J. Wess, late of Baltimore City,
deceased, of record in the Office of the Register of Wills
of Baltimore City, in Wills Liber J. H. B. 188, folio 78, viz:

St. Joseph's Hospital.

Associated Professors of Loyola College.

35. To devises and bequests contained in the Last Will
and Testament of John H. Lederer, late of Baltimore City,
deceased, of record in the Office of the Register of Wills
of Baltimore City, in Wills Liber J. H. B. 184, folio 343, viz:

Oblate Sisters of Providence.

36. To devises and bequests contained in the Last Will
and Testament of George R. Clautice, late of Baltimore
County, deceased, of record in the Office of the Register of
Wills of Baltimore County, in Wills Liber J. P. C. 34, folio
43, to Most Reverend Michael J. Curley, Archbishop of
Baltimore, a corporation sole.

37. To devises and bequests contained in the Last Will
and Testament of Anthony Passagno, late of Baltimore City,
deceased, of record in the Office of the Register of Wills of
Baltimore City, in Wills Liber J. H. B. 194, folio 468, viz:

St. Vincent's Church.

St. Anthony's Church.

Lady of Mt. Carmel Church.

St. Leo's Orphan Asylum.

St. Anthony's Orphan Asylum.

St. Vincent's Orphan Asylum.

38. To devises and bequests contained in the Last Will
and Testament of Edward Kearney, late of Baltimore City,
deceased, of record in the Office of the Register of Wills
of Baltimore City, in Liber S. R. M. 81, folio 520, viz:

Associated Professors of Loyola College of the City of
Baltimore.

St. Mary's Female Orphan Asylum of Baltimore.

Catholic University of America.
